Recently, HDB has released news that they will be launching a new open-concept layout which will be offered as part of a trial program. These BTO “white flats” will be launched for sale in October, starting with the Kallang-Whampoa area. Household shelters, commonly termed “bomb shelters” by Singaporeans, are a feature that all HDB flats built after 1996 are equipped with.
